What to do if a kitten has bad mouth

Methods to deal with kittens with bad mouth:
1. Feed easily digestible food. You can feed some easily digestible food and add an appropriate amount of probiotics to speed up gastrointestinal digestion.
2. Clean your teeth regularly. If the kitten's teeth are very dirty and have a lot of tartar, you can brush the cat's teeth regularly to help it develop this habit. If the situation is serious, you can send it to a pet hospital for professional cleaning to avoid oral infection and bad breath.
3. Supplement vitamins. To match the diet reasonably, you can feed some carrots and cabbage appropriately to supplement vitamin B in the body.
4. Take antibiotics. If your cat’s stomatitis is severe, you should take your cat to a pet hospital for antibiotics.
5. Tooth extraction. It may be due to oral infection. Frequent feeding of canned or soft food to cats may lead to gingivitis. In more serious cases, it may lead to tooth nerve necrosis and the tooth must be extracted at a pet hospital.
